Updated D-Pad: Provides precise input and tactile feedback for superior control.
Textured Grips: Strategically placed on triggers, bumpers, and the back-case for improved grip and comfort during intense gaming sessions.
Ergonomic Design: Crafted to fit a wide range of hand sizes, ensuring comfortable gameplay for diverse users.
Share Button: Allows for instant capture and sharing of screenshots or video clips of your best gaming moments.
Multi-Device Connectivity: Seamlessly switch and connect via Bluetooth to Xbox Series X|S, PC, and Android devices, offering broad compatibility.
3.5 mm Audio Jack: Conveniently connect your favorite gaming headset directly to the controller for immersive audio.
Customizable Button Mapping: Personalize your gaming experience by remapping buttons through the Xbox Accessories app.
Wired Play Option: Includes a 2.7-meter USB Type-C cable for a reliable, lag-free wired connection.

Ensure your Xbox console is powered on.
Press and hold the Xbox button on the controller until it flashes.
Press the Pair button on your Xbox console (located near the USB port).
Press and hold the Pair button on the top of the controller (between the bumpers) until the Xbox button on the controller flashes rapidly, then stays solid. This indicates a successful connection.
Via Bluetooth: Ensure your PC has Bluetooth enabled. Go to Settings > Devices > Bluetooth & other devices > Add Bluetooth or other device. Select Bluetooth and then press and hold the Pair button on your controller until the Xbox button flashes rapidly. Select the controller from the list on your PC.
Via USB-C Cable: Connect the included 2.7m USB Type-C cable from the controller to an available USB port on your PC. The controller will be automatically detected and ready for use.
Enable Bluetooth on your Android device.
Press and hold the Pair button on the controller until the Xbox button flashes rapidly.
On your Android device, scan for new Bluetooth devices and select the Xbox Wireless Controller when it appears. Note: Some features may not be supported on Android devices.

Cleaning: Use a soft, dry, or slightly damp cloth to wipe down the controller. Avoid using harsh chemicals or abrasive cleaners.
Storage: Store the controller in a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ight and extreme temperatures.
Handling: Avoid dropping the controller or subjecting it to strong impacts to prevent damage to internal components.
